USB Easy Transfer Cable for file transfer between 2 XP machines

It appears that the Easy Transfer Cable is a special USB cable
designed for communication between an XP and Vista system. It seems
to me, that the same cable with the appropriate driver, could be used
between 2 XP systems. I am not interested in running the Easy
Transfer software, rather just having a means to provide a quick link
between two XP machines. I would think that with the proper driver,
one of the machines could look like a peripheral device. I image this
is one of the things that the Easy Transfer Cable software provides
and I am guessing that it makes the Vista machine look like a
periheral.

Is there something electrically special about the Easy Transfer Cable
or is the magic in the driver, and if so, has some enterprising person
written that driver to run under XP?
